import {
Alert,
Linking,
NativeModules,
PermissionsAndroid,
Platform,
} from 'react-native';
import { localize } from '../resources/CometChatLocalize/CometChatLocalize';
import { anyObject } from './TypeUtils';
const { FileManager } = NativeModules;
let instance: PermissionUtilIOS;
const permissionStatus = {
'Not Determined': 0,
'Restricted': 1,
'Denied': 2,
'Authorized': 3,
'Unknown': -1,
} as const;
const permissionStatusAndroid = {
granted: 3,
denied: 2,
never_ask_again: 2,
} as any;
const permissibleResources = ['camera', 'mic'] as const;
const permissionMapAndroid: any = {
camera: PermissionsAndroid.PERMISSIONS.CAMERA,
mic: PermissionsAndroid.PERMISSIONS.RECORD_AUDIO,
};
type TPermissibleResources = (typeof permissibleResources)[number];
type ValueOf<T> = T[keyof T];
type TPermissionStatus = ValueOf<typeof permissionStatus>;
const permissionStore: any = {
camera: permissionStatus.Unknown,
mic: permissionStatus.Unknown,
};
class PermissionUtilIOS {
status = permissionStatus;
constructor() {
if (instance) {
throw new Error('New instance cannot be created!!');
}
instance = this;
}
async init() {
try {
if (Platform.OS === "ios") {
const res: Record<TPermissibleResources, TPermissionStatus> =
await FileManager.checkResourcesPermission(['mic', 'camera']);
for (const resourceType in res) {
permissionStore[resourceType as TPermissibleResources] =
res[resourceType as TPermissibleResources];
}
permissionStore.camera = res.camera;
permissionStore.mic = res.mic;
} else if (Platform.OS === "android") {
for (const resourceType of permissibleResources) {
const isGranted = await PermissionsAndroid.check(permissionMapAndroid[resourceType]);
permissionStore[resourceType] = isGranted ? permissionStatus.Authorized : permissionStatus['Not Determined'];
}
}
return true;
} catch (error: any) {
return false;
}
}
async get(resources: TPermissibleResources[]) {
return resources.map((resource) => {
if (!permissibleResources.includes(resource)) {
throw new Error('Invalid resource type');
}
return permissionStore[resource];
});
}
async request(resources: TPermissibleResources[]) {
for (const resource of resources) {
if (!permissibleResources.includes(resource)) {
throw new Error('Invalid resource type');
}
}
if (Platform.OS === 'ios') {
const res: Record<TPermissibleResources, TPermissionStatus> =
await FileManager.requestResourcesPermission(resources);
for (const resourceType in res) {
permissionStore[resourceType as TPermissibleResources] =
res[resourceType as TPermissibleResources];
}
} else if (Platform.OS === 'android') {
const res: any = await PermissionsAndroid.requestMultiple(resources.map(item => permissionMapAndroid[item]));
const permissionMapAndroidRevert: anyObject = {};
for (const resource in permissionMapAndroid) {
permissionMapAndroidRevert[permissionMapAndroid[resource]] = resource;
}
for (const androidResource in res) {
permissionStore[permissionMapAndroidRevert[androidResource]] =
permissionStatusAndroid[res[androidResource]];
}
}
}
async startResourceBasedTask(resources: TPermissibleResources[]) {
const resourcePermStatuses = await this.get(resources);
let allResourcesAllowed = true;
for (let i = 0; i < resourcePermStatuses.length; i++) {
const resourcePermStatus = resourcePermStatuses[i];
if (resourcePermStatus === this.status['Not Determined'] || (Platform.OS === "android" && resourcePermStatuses[i] === this.status.Denied)) {
await this.request([resources[i]]);
[resourcePermStatuses[i]] = await this.get([resources[i]]);
}
if (resourcePermStatuses[i] === this.status.Denied) {
allResourcesAllowed = false;
}
}
if (allResourcesAllowed === false) {
Alert.alert('', localize('CAMERA_PERMISSION'), [
{
style: 'cancel',
text: localize('CANCEL'),
},
{
style: 'default',
text: localize('SETTINGS'),
onPress: () => {
Linking.openSettings();
},
},
]);
}
return allResourcesAllowed;
}
}
export const permissionUtil = Object.freeze(new PermissionUtilIOS());
